🥘 Ingredients

11 items
  • 0.5 cup unsalted butter
  • 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 0.5 cup brown sugar, packed
  • 3 large eggs
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 0.75 cup all-purpose flour
  • 0.25 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on baking powder
  • 0.5 cup optional mix-ins (e.g., chopped nuts, chocolate chips, dried fruit, or candy pieces)

📝 Instructions

10 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ease or line an 8x8-inch (20x20 cm) square baking dish with parchment paper.

2

In a large microwave-safe bowl, melt the butter and 1 cup of semi-sweet chocolate chips together in 30-second intervals, stirring between each interval until smooth. Allow it to cool slightly.

3

Whisk in the granulated sugar and brown sugar until well combined.

4

Add the eggs, one at a time, whisking well after each addition. Stir in the vanilla extract.

5

Using a sieve, sift the flour, cocoa powder, salt, and baking powder directly into the bowl. Fold the dry ingredients into the wet ingredients using a spatula until just combined. Do not overmix.

6

If using mix-ins, gently fold them into the batter at this stage.

7

Pour the batter into the prepared baking dish, spreading it evenly with the spatula.

8

Bake in the preheated oven for 28–32 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out with a few moist crumbs (not wet batter). Be careful not to overbake.

9

Remove from the oven and allow the brownies to cool completely in the pan before slicing into 12 squares.

10

Serve as is, or dust with powdered sugar for presentation. For a twist, consider topping with a drizzle of melted chocolate or a scoop of vanilla ice cream.
